
The average Deutsche Bank Sales Manager in San Francisco earns an estimated $178,128 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$121,538 with a $56,590 bonus. Deutsche Bank's Sales Manager compensation is $60,698 more than the US average for a Sales Manager. Sales Manager salaries at Deutsche Bank in San Francisco can range from $51,500 - $378,000.
